Love your neighbor as yourself. It’s such a simple command, yet most

Americans don’t even know their neighbors—and you can’t love somebody

you don’t know.

Did you know that God enjoys watching the people he created have fellowship with each other? In Zechariah 3:10, he says, “Each of you will invite your neighbor to come and enjoy peace and security, surrounded by your vineyards and fig trees” (GNT).

You probably don’t have vineyards in your backyard, but you might

have a flower garden, a fire pit, or just a patch of grass. The point is

not to have a pretty place to offer, but to make the choice to be

friendly and get to know your neighbors.

One reason we never host our church’s Trunk’R’Treat on the same date

as Halloween is because we want to encourage our congregation to get out

and meet their neighbors. Even if Halloween isn’t your thing, you can

still be a friendly neighbor while everyone is out. This is a unique

time that offers a lot of opportunities to get to know the people around

you. Why not just sit on your front porch, wave, give out candy and

even greet the people going by? You never know when a friendly gesture

might eventually lead to spiritual conversations.
